Lloyd Sicard Wins at Big West Challenge

 

FULLERTON, Calif. --- Sophomore Lloyd Sicard led UC Irvine with a first-place finish in the Big West Challenge at Fullerton Friday night.

Sicard won the 110-meter hurdles in a meet-record 13.92 at the Titan Track Complex in the 23rd annual competition between UCI, Cal State Fullerton, Long Beach State and UC Santa Barbara.

Kyle Hubbard placed fourth in the 110 hurdles in 14.74 and Cameron Vaca was sixth in 14.83.

Mason Miller finished second in the shot put with a mark of 55-2 ¼ and he was fifth in the discus throw (153-3).  Mike Graf recorded a second-place finish in the long jump at 22-9 ¼.

Matt Dispenza placed third in the high jump at a height of 6-4 ¾ and he was seventh in the triple jump at 42-9 ¾.

The 'Eaters' 4x400 relay of Vaca, Sicard, Duane Solomon and Brandon Howard recorded a third-place time of 3:16.51.

Hubbard finished fourth in the 400-meter hurdles in 54.35 and Alex Tebbe was fifth in the 1500 meters with a time of 3:56.77 and Riley Martin sixth in 3:59.40.

In the 3,000 meters, Blake Wanser placed fourth in 8:36.65, Izzak Mireles was fifth in 8:37.60 and Nolan Del Valle sixth in 8:39.50.

Kolton Cody had a sixth-place finish of 11.04 in the 100 meters, Howard was sixth in the 200 meters (22.51) and Tommy Newton-Neal sixth in the 3,000-meter steeplechase (9:36.0).

UCI placed fourth in the team standings with 100 points as Long Beach State won with 222.

The Anteaters have a full slate of action next week with the Mt. SAC Relays April 16-18, the Bryan Clay Invitational in Azusa April 17 and the Beach Invitational at Cerritos College in Norwalk April 17-18.
